This is 26" remy in 2 colours installed with protac, 3 rows at back bottom 2 doubled, 2 rows at side bottom one doubled, pic taken after wash and curl with hotsticks sorry I forgot to take before in my hurry to get it in!! My hair is bra length and very fine this is my 3rd install with protac I'm a complete convert I love them!!!

It is uk supplies hair I always try hair before I fit it to customers, it is not too tangly but I do plait it quite a bit, I find if it rubs on man made fibre clothes and collars etc it tangles worse.  I use l oreal vitamino colour conditioner on it its really good for making it silky.

I know what you are saying. I starting using TRESemme instant heat tamer, with my flatiron for the top and cant believe the difference. Out of all the brands Ive tried this one works the best for me. Its very light weight, leaves no stickiness or stiffness, and just leaves my top hair so smooth and flat. And this is the best blending of the top Ive had since Ive worn extensions. And it can be used all over before blowdrying, or with a curling iron too.
